AgVenture extends its reach to central Minnesota growers

.

Kentland, Indiana
August 29, 2008

Extending its reach across the state of Minnesota, AgVenture, Inc. has announced the addition of their newest Regional Seed Company, Corn Capital Genetics, LLC. Co-owners Jeff Keltgen and Steve O’Neill will provide farmers across a significant part of the south central Minnesota market with AgVenture® brand corn, soybeans and alfalfa. Corn Capital Genetics is based in Olivia in Renville County, Minnesota’s top corn producing county.

The Keltgen family name is well recognized in Minnesota. Jeff has more than 20 years seed industry experience. AgVenture, Inc. is the nation’s largest network of independently owned regional seed companies. Based in Kentland, Indiana, AgVenture provides this growing network of independently owned and managed seed business owners with seed products meeting exacting standards for quality, together with leading-edge genetics and technology. Since 1983, this unique marketing approach has allowed each individual company to match the hybrids it sells to the specific needs of the geographical area it serves. Combined with professional seed representation at a local level, AgVenture strives to help every grower realize more profit from every field.
